TITLE- ODM Developer
LOCATION- REMOTE (must sit on West Coast)
LOCATION- REMOTE (must sit on West Coast)
Washington, DC(ONLY LOCALS)
DURATION- 6 MONTHS
INTERVIEW- VIDEO
Required Skills
8+ years experience in developing, deploying, and managing business rules, decision tables, and rule flows.
Proven expertise in implementing and optimizing business rules using IBM ODM
Advanced experience integrating rule engines within Java-based enterprise applications, leveraging Spring, REST APIs, and modern frameworks.
Strong understanding of decision modeling (DMN) and rule authoring best practices to ensure scalability, maintainability, and performance.
Skilled in testing, debugging, and tuning rule executions across multiple environments.
Experience with Git, Maven, Jenkins, or similar tools for version control, build automation, and CI/CD processes.
Ability to collaborate with analysts, architects, and developers to align business rules with organizational policies and technical architectures.
Prior experience supporting a State Medicaid/Eligibility project
Responsibilities:
Design, develop, and implement business rules and decision services using IBM ODM or other BRMS tools.
Work closely with business analysts and stakeholders to translate requirements into executable decision logic.
Develop, test, and deploy decision artifacts, ruleflows, and data models to support enterprise systems.
Integrate ODM solutions with Java applications, APIs, and databases to enable real-time decision processing.
Perform unit testing, regression testing, and validation of business rules to ensure accuracy and performance.
Maintain and optimize rule repositories, ensuring compliance with governance and version control standards.
